Yi-Sin Chen is a scholar working on Biomedical Engineering, Molecular Biology and Cancer Research. According to data from OpenAlex, Yi-Sin Chen has authored 15 papers receiving a total of 378 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Biomedical Engineering, 10 papers in Molecular Biology and 4 papers in Cancer Research. Recurrent topics in Yi-Sin Chen's work include Extracellular vesicles in disease (7 papers), Microfluidic and Bio-sensing Technologies (5 papers) and Nanopore and Nanochannel Transport Studies (5 papers). Yi-Sin Chen is often cited by papers focused on Extracellular vesicles in disease (7 papers), Microfluidic and Bio-sensing Technologies (5 papers) and Nanopore and Nanochannel Transport Studies (5 papers). Yi-Sin Chen collaborates with scholars based in Taiwan, United Kingdom and Russia. Yi-Sin Chen's co-authors include Gwo‐Bin Lee, Yu-Dong Ma, Chihchen Chen, Wei‐Yen Hsu, Po-Chiun Huang, Charles Pin‐Kuang Lai, Chien-Yu Fu, Chih‐Hung Wang, Yen‐Wen Chen and Yu‐Lin Wang and has published in prestigious journals such as SHILAP Revista de lepidopterología, IEEE Access and Sensors and Actuators B Chemical.

All Works

15 of 15 papers shown
1.
Chen, Yi-Sin, Chihchen Chen, Charles Pin‐Kuang Lai, & Gwo‐Bin Lee. (2022). Isolation and digital counting of extracellular vesicles from blood via membrane-integrated microfluidics. Sensors and Actuators B Chemical. 358. 131473–131473. 20 indexed citations
3.
Chen, Yi-Sin, Charles Pin‐Kuang Lai, Chihchen Chen, & Gwo‐Bin Lee. (2021). Isolation and recovery of extracellular vesicles using optically-induced dielectrophoresis on an integrated microfluidic platform. Lab on a Chip. 21(8). 1475–1483. 35 indexed citations
4.
Kuo, Yu‐Hsuan, et al.. (2021). A miniaturized, DNA-FET biosensor-based microfluidic system for quantification of two breast cancer biomarkers. Microfluidics and Nanofluidics. 25(4). 32 indexed citations
5.
Chen, Yi-Sin, et al.. (2021). A multiplexed nanoliter array-based microfluidic platform for quick, automatic antimicrobial susceptibility testing. Lab on a Chip. 21(11). 2223–2231. 16 indexed citations
6.
Hsu, Wei‐Yen & Yi-Sin Chen. (2021). Single Image Dehazing Using Wavelet-Based Haze-Lines and Denoising. IEEE Access. 9. 104547–104559. 33 indexed citations
7.
Chen, Yi-Sin, et al.. (2021). Isolation and quantification of extracellular vesicle-encapsulated microRNA on an integrated microfluidic platform. Lab on a Chip. 21(23). 4660–4671. 20 indexed citations
10.
Wang, Chih‐Hung, Yi-Sin Chen, Chun‐Chih Chien, et al.. (2020). An integrated microfluidic system for early detection of sepsis-inducing bacteria. Lab on a Chip. 21(1). 113–121. 44 indexed citations
11.
Chen, Yi-Sin, et al.. (2020). A CMOS-Based Capacitive Biosensor for Detection of a Breast Cancer MicroRNA Biomarker. SHILAP Revista de lepidopterología. 1. 157–162. 14 indexed citations
12.
13.
Ma, Yu-Dong, Yi-Sin Chen, & Gwo‐Bin Lee. (2019). An integrated self-driven microfluidic device for rapid detection of the influenza A (H1N1) virus by reverse transcription loop-mediated isothermal amplification. Sensors and Actuators B Chemical. 296. 126647–126647. 70 indexed citations
14.
Chen, Yi-Sin, et al.. (2019). Generating digital drug cocktails via optical manipulation of drug-containing particles and photo-patterning of hydrogels. Lab on a Chip. 19(10). 1764–1771. 15 indexed citations
15.
Fu, Chien-Yu, Yen‐Wen Chen, Yi-Sin Chen, et al.. (2018). Detecting miRNA biomarkers from extracellular vesicles for cardiovascular disease with a microfluidic system. Lab on a Chip. 18(19). 2917–2925. 66 indexed citations
